OpenX Launches Bids on Snowflake Data Marketplace to Streamline Access to Log-level Data

OpenX, a Pasadena-based programmatic advertising exchange connecting 120,000+ advertisers and 130,000+ publisher domains, faced growing demand for granular, log-level bid data. Delivering millions-row spreadsheets was slow, costly, and operationally burdensome, preventing near–real-time insights and diverting engineering resources from scalable solutions.

To address this, OpenX launched the Bidding Intelligence Data Set (BIDS) on Snowflake Data Marketplace, standardizing a 40-field log-level product and using Snowflake’s multi-cluster architecture and extensive connectors for easy BI integration. Partners now get near–real-time access at lower storage and compute cost, enabling faster data science, better campaign optimization and ROAS, and the ability to fulfill nearly all log-level data requests while freeing technical staff for higher-value work.
